==Signs and symptoms== About 66% of women have both nausea and vomiting while 33% have just nausea.<ref name=ACOG2015Full/> Symptoms of both nausea and vomiting will normally climax around 10 and 16 weeks of pregnancy, subsiding around 20 weeks.<ref name=":1" /> However, after around 22 weeks, up to 10% of women continue to have lingering symptoms.<ref name=":1">{{cite journal | vauthors = Lee NM, Saha S | title = Nausea and vomiting of pregnancy | journal = Gastroenterology Clinics of North America | volume = 40 | issue = 2 | pages = 309β34, vii | date = June 2011 | pmid = 21601782 | pmc = 3676933 | doi = 10.1016/j.gtc.2011.03.009 }}</ref>
